Additional information

If a lightning stroke was detected, some additional information correspondending to the station Huntsville (Green Mtn) will be displayed.

  • Runtime: Difference between time of stroke and reception
  • Distance: Distance stroke to station Huntsville (Green Mtn) calculated from runtime (1ms = 300km)
  • Direction: Approximate direction (exact value won' be displayed due to usage limitations)
  • Deviation: The smaller, the better the locating
  • Current: Current of the stroke. Very experimental! Currently almost no informative value!
  • Polarity: Positive/negative lightning. Is determined out of signal. Very experimental, only suitable for near lightning!
  • Participants: Number of stations that received the lightning stroke. The more, the better.
  • Participanted: Did the station Huntsville (Green Mtn) participate? If "no" is colored, then a signal has been received but it wasn't used for the calculation
  • Locating angle: Max. angle of participated station around lightning position (in parenthesis: stations that weren't used for calculation). A value of 270° would be ideal, but a good locating is also possible on much smaller values.
  • Channel: Recorded channel in the graph (if station operates in "Best Channel Mode")
